Output 3259121429b96ffd31d9da763ef535a0f23eeec3d156b086695689d1fe49f112:1

value
51809086
script pubkey
OP_0 OP_PUSHBYTES_32 a84403a8a685daffe4796bdb8666ae10ba978299a5f01a4d6c12b11312098053
address
bc1q4pzq829xshd0lered0dcve4wzzaf0q5e5hcp5ntvz2c3xysfspfskk0ujh
transaction
3259121429b96ffd31d9da763ef535a0f23eeec3d156b086695689d1fe49f112
spent
true